West Stoughton Village sits at 55 Brian Drive in Stoughton, MA, near the intersection of Randolph Street and West Street. This low-rise building, completed in 1973, has a simple yet inviting design. Surrounded by a mix of amenities, it offers residents a pleasant environment. The building consists of 8 condominium units. Each unit ranges from 1,200 to 1,300 square feet and contains 2 bedrooms. Recent prices for these units are between $370,000 and $375,100. The average price per square foot stands at $300. Units typically spend about 49 days on the market before selling. Amenities in the area enhance daily life. Residents have access to golf, a playground, a fitness center, and a sauna. Several tennis courts and a swimming pool contribute to outdoor activities. Nearby, one can find options like Roxannes Taqueria for dining and Code Ninjas for educational needs. Public transportation and highway access make commuting straightforward. A local shopping center managed by Wilder Companies is within reach, covering essential shopping needs. For those who enjoy nature, the Neponset River is nearby. The building emphasizes a community feel. The clubhouse offers a space to gather, while shared amenities encourage an active lifestyle. Low-rise construction creates a cozy atmosphere, making it a great place to call home.
